Lindsay Anderson

Creative Director And Strategist at Strategy Muse

Lindsay Anderson is an accomplished creative professional with extensive experience in brand and marketing strategy. Currently serving as the President and Chief Creative at Unlabeled since January 2023, Lindsay focuses on developing authentic brands through a blend of design thinking, psychology, and storytelling. As Creative Director and Strategist at Strategy Muse since March 2017, Lindsay also brings a wealth of knowledge from previous roles, including Creative Director at the Kellogg School of Management, Senior Interactive Art Director at Tribal Worldwide and Fathom Communications, Founder and Creative Director at 44Percent, and Creative Strategist at Health Brand Group. Educational credentials include a Bachelor of Arts in English and Spanish from the University of Colorado and various advanced studies in strategic marketing communications and advertising from Northwestern University.

Strategy Muse

Strategy Muse is a different kind of company. We are a consulting co-op with a wide range of expertise and deep experience in communication, leadership, change management and design. We combine critical thinking with creativity to spark innovation that turns our clients’ strategies into action. OUR BUSINESS IS DESIGNED WITH CLIENTS IN MIND We are a network of independent consultants working under the Strategy Muse™ brand name. This operating model keeps our overhead costs and billing rates low. WE WORK WITH BOTH SIDES OF THE BRAIN Our team is a motley crew—we are communicators, designers, storytellers, political strategists, facilitators, scientists, artists and coaches. The diverse backgrounds fuel creative problem solving and innovation. WE FLEX OUR STYLE TO WORK IN YOUR ORGANIZATION Creativity inspires us and we like pushing the envelope…but we’re not tone deaf. We have worked in corporate, agency, academic, arts, government and non-profit environments and are skilled in navigating different types of organizations.
